柯林斯词典

  • VERB 起源于;来自;由…造成
    If a condition or problemstems fromsomething, it was caused originally by that thing.
    1. All my problems stem from drink...
      我所有的问题都源于酗酒。
    2. Much of the instability stems from the economic effects of the war.
      不稳定局面多半是由战争对经济的影响造成的。
  • VERB 阻止;遏制;制止
    If youstemsomething, you stop it spreading, increasing, or continuing.
    1. Austria has sent three army battalions to its border with Hungary to stem the flow of illegal immigrants...
      奥地利已派出 3 个营的兵力去本国和匈牙利交界的边境地区阻止非法移民的流入。
    2. The authorities seem powerless to stem the rising tide of violence...
      当局似乎无力阻止愈演愈烈的暴力活动。
    3. He was still conscious, trying to stem the bleeding with his right hand.
      他依然清醒,正试图用右手止血。
  • N-COUNT (植物的)秆,茎,梗
    Thestemof a plant is the thin, upright part on which the flowers and leaves grow.
    1. He stooped down, cut the stem for her with his knife and handed her the flower.
      他弯下腰,用刀替她将花茎割断,然后将花递给她。
